Subject: DR drill — TileCache layer, Thursday

Team,

Thursday's disaster-recovery drill covers the Quellmont tile-rendering cache layer. We'll simulate total loss of the warm cache in the Ostbridge region and fail over to cold storage. Reviewers: check the failover patch before Wednesday — specifically eviction ordering and the TTL reset logic. Expect degraded map loads for ~20 minutes during the drill window. No customer comms needed; this is staging only.

To join the drill vault and follow along, use the passphrase below.

unlock words, bahop-fawef: novmir-druwyn-soriel-rusdor-kasion

## TKT-4182: Config drift on Deploybot

Hey — noticed Deploybot in the Quill workspace has drifted from what's in the repo. It's announcing to the wrong channel after the last manual hotfix, and the polling interval looks hand-edited too (someone bumped it to 10s, which is hammering the status API). Can you reconcile the live box against source and redeploy? Please don't just edit in place again. For reference, here's what the running instance currently reports as its configuration values.

config for kajog-tadug:
[casax]
port = 11211
region = west-3
host = casax.nelvroworks.internal
timeout_ms = 5000
retries = 7

// Tracing constants for the Quillbridge request-tracing layer.
// Every hop between Quillbridge microservices must propagate the trace
// context verbatim; these constants bound header size, sampling, and
// span retention so a malicious upstream cannot inflate trace storage.
// Values were reviewed against the Hallowmere threat model last quarter.
// The enforced limits are defined below.

tuning table, kajog-kawef:
PRIORITIES = {
    "kelox": 870,
    "kasix": 89,
    "eliax": 988,
}

## Support

Tracelace stitches request traces across all Harborfen microservices. If spans are missing, check that the propagation header is forwarded by the gateway first. Most gaps come from sidecar misconfig, not the collector. Include a trace ID and rough timestamp in every report. For anything the docs don't cover, send details to the tracing team here.

escalation mailbox, bafog-fafog: ulador@paliqlabs.internal